How Do I Connect My PS4 to a Hotspot?

How To Connect a PS4 to a WiFi Hotspot (1)

Usually, we use a mobile phone data network (4G/5G) to create a hotspot connection, which acts as an available WiFi connection to other devices.

So, to connect your PS4 with your phone data, you’ll first need to establish a hotspot on your phone and then allow the PS4 to connect to the newly created hotspot’s WiFi network.

Of course, it would almost always be better to connect a PS4 to a normal 5GHz or 2.4GHz WiFi network because gaming consoles can use a lot of data.

Setting up a mobile hotspot is pretty simple.There are a few simple taps on your smartphone, and the hotspot will be up and running.

iPhone users can follow these steps:

  1. Go to ‘Settings’ and tap on Mobile Data.
  2. Tap on Personal Hotspot.
  3. Toggle the switch to ON.
  4. Set a password to secure your hotspot.
  5. By default, your hotspot is named after your iPhone’s model. You can either keep it or customize it in the ‘About’ section of your device’s general setting.

After setting up a hotspot, make sure it is not restricted to specific devices. To check this, go to your device’s ‘Setting’ then tap on ‘Wireless and Network.’ There you’ll see ‘Tethering and hotspot;’ click on it.

Now see if ‘Allowed device only’ is unchecked. If the box is checked, uncheck it or add your PS4 manually under ‘Manually add a device.’

Android users can follow these steps:

  1. Turn on your Mobile Data.
  2. Go to the dropdown menu and tap on ‘Mobile Hotspot’ for 2-3 seconds.
  3. In the new window, toggle the ‘Off’ to ‘On.’
  4. If you want to change your name and password, you’ll see the option right below the toggle switch.
  5. Tap on the setting icon on the top right corner and select ‘Configure Mobile Hotspot’ to enter additional settings.
  6. Here, you can change the visibility of your device. Make sure it is set to visible so your PS4 can find and connect to it.
  7. Now, set up your PS4 to connect to the hotspot.

After following the steps above, your mobile hotspot is ready to use. Now it’s time to connect your PS4 to the hotspot:

  1. To connect PS4 to mobile hotspot, turn on your PS4 and go to Settings.
  2. Select ‘Network’ and then ‘Set up internet connection.’
  3. From there, select ‘Use Wi-Fi’ and then ‘Easy.’ The PS4 will then scan for the available hotspot.
  4. Select your mobile hotspot connection and enter the password you set earlier to connect your PS4 to the hotspot.

As long as your PS4 is within the range of your hotspot, it should be able to establish a stable connection. That’s all you need to do. Your PS4 is now connected to the hotspot, and it will use the mobile data connection to play PS4 games.

However, here we must mention that the PS4 uses a lot of data, so if you have a data capped plan, it’ll probably eat up your quota in no time.

How Can I Link My Phone to My PS4?

Sony has always been ahead of the game when it comes to connectivity. With PS4 and later models of the PlayStation, you can now directly link your devices to the PS4 console with the PlayStation app compatible with iOS and Android devices.

This app lets you control your PS4 PlayStation Account and do all the game browsing on your phone screen.

  1. To link your phone with PS4, first, download the PlayStation app from your respective app store. After installing it, open the app and sign in to your PlayStation account. If you don’t have one, create a new one.
  2. Now on the app’s main menu, select ‘Connect to PS4.’
  3. Give the app permission to your device’s data and location.
  4. Your app will scan for the PS4 connected with your account; you will see a space to add a code once it is found.
  5. Now turn on your PS4 console, go to ‘Setting,’ and select ‘PlayStation App Connection.’ There you’ll see the option to add a device; click on it. It’ll provide you with the code.
  6. Type this code in the app on your phone and select ‘Ok.’ You are now linked to your PS4.

With this connection, you can stream PS4 games on your phone, message or chat with your PSN friends, browse the game library, buy new games, and do all the fun stuff you would typically do on your console. Following these steps, you can link up to sixteen devices with one PS4.

Why Won’t My PS4 Connect to a Hotspot?

If you have followed all the steps correctly and your PS4 still won’t connect, there might be a problem with the network or the hotspot you’re using. So let’s break down the possible issues and troubleshoot.

Your PS4 is not in the range: Try to move closer to the hotspot device; most devices have a maximum range of around 15 to 20 meters (50-65 feet). Keep in mind that walls and other obstructions might reduce the signal strength.

Your mobile is not connected to the internet: Make sure both mobile data and hotspot are activated on your phone. No internet connection on your phone means no internet for the connected PS4.

The Hotspot Security is not allowing the PS4: Check your hotspot security settings and ensure it’s configured to allow your PS4. We have already explained the process above.

You’ve consumed the data package: Hotspot works on your phone’s data plan. If you have reached your monthly data limit, it means your phone is not connected to any internet, and so your PS4 will also have no internet connection.

Sometimes minor glitches in network connection can lead to such problems. First, turn off your hotspot and reconnect both devices. Then, if the issue is still there, try restarting both your PS4 and mobile phone.

Also, try to connect your phone with other hotspot devices like laptops or desktops. This will help you learn if it’s a problem with a particular hotspot device or with your PS4. For further assistance, you can reach out to PlayStation support.

Can I Use My PS4 as a Hotspot?

Many people don’t know the hidden feature that PlayStation 4 can work as a hotspot. This means you can use your PS4 to provide gameplay access to other devices using Wi-Fi.

It comes in handy when there is no other Wi-Fi connection around, or you don’t have a hotspot device to play a shared game.

However, here we should clarify that this hotspot feature does not provide internet access to connected devices—it is only for game streaming and remote play over Wi-Fi.

This feature is not enabled by default, so you need to turn it on.

  1. To use a PS4 hotspot, go to the ‘Settings’ menu on your PS4 and select ‘Wi-Fi Hotspot.’
  2. Click ‘Yes’ on the prompt window.
  3. Click ‘Yes’ again on the following prompt to start the hotspot.
  4. The Wi-Fi hotspot will now turn on and be visible to compatible devices.

To connect your phone with the PS4 hotspot, open the Wi-Fi menu from your phone settings and find the name of your PS4 hotspot. Then, click on it to connect. It won’t need any password; usually, PlayStation 4 hotspot is an open connection since it only works for remote play.

You may now play or stream your online games on your smartphone using a PS4 hotspot. However, remember that the PS4 hotspot is not as strong as other devices, and the best signal strength is within 5 to 10 feet of your console.

How much data does PS4 use on hotspot? ›

Online gaming with a PS4 uses anywhere from 30-250 MB per hour. Things like downloading and updating games take a lot more data. You could play online for 2 years with the data it takes to download one game! The average PS4 game download size is 13.08GB.

Is hotspot faster than Wi-Fi? ›

Data speeds

Average home internet broadband speeds are around 90-100Mbps. This is enough to support several devices connected at the same time. On the other hand, 4G LTE mobile hotspot speeds tend to range between 30-60Mbps.
